Parwaaz Hai Junoon, the Haseeb Hasan directorial, has become a favourite for media fodder. In what started off with the announcement of a stellar cast consisting of Osman Khalid Butt, Hamza Ali Abbasi, and reportedly, Mahira Khan, quickly turned into a PR conundrum with at least two of the cast members being replaced.

While rumours were abuzz for the last few months about Mahira Khan never signing up for the film, and her subsequent replacement by the newbie Hania Aamir, the latest update turned into reality when OKB also decided to leave the film over ‘date issues’. Much speculation followed, with several websites even suggesting that OKB was considered “not macho enough” for the role. Okay then.

Taking to Facebook to announce his decision after being hounded by various journalists, the Balu Mahi star revealed all that everyone was wondering about.

“It all boiled down to a severe conflict in dates/schedules. Shoot for Parwaaz got delayed (we were supposed to begin shooting beginning then mid-December).. and the team at HUM knew mid-January onwards would be impossible for me to commit to,” the actor wrote.

Replaced by Ahad Raza Mir, the son of veteran director/producer Asif Raza Mir, Butt seemed to be glad to be replaced by another thespian. “I have the utmost faith in Ahad Raza Mir (who is now doing the role), a fellow thespian…I’m sure he will be utterly kick-ass in the film!” the actor commented.
